华为云代理商:Java队列传输的高效解决方案
引言
在当今云计算时代,高效、稳定的数据传输是企业应用开发中的关键需求之一。Java作为一种广泛使用的编程语言,其在队列传输领域的应用尤为突出。作为华为云代理商,我们深知华为云在Java队列传输方面的优势,能够为企业提供强大的技术支持与解决方案。本文将详细介绍华为云在Java队列传输中的优势,并通过多个小标题展开具体分析,帮助读者全面了解华为云的价值。
华为云在Java队列传输中的核心优势
1. 高可靠性与稳定性
华为云提供的高可用消息队列服务(如分布式消息服务DMS)能够确保消息的可靠传输。其采用多副本存储机制,消息持久化存储,即使在硬件故障或网络波动的情况下,也能保证数据不丢失。对于Java开发者而言,华为云提供的SDK能够无缝集成到现有应用中,确保队列传输的高效与稳定。
2. 高性能与低延迟
华为云的消息队列服务基于分布式架构设计,支持高并发、低延迟的消息处理。通过智能负载均衡和动态扩容机制,华为云能够应对突发流量,确保消息队列的高吞吐量。对于Java应用来说,这意味着开发者可以轻松实现毫秒级响应的队列传输,满足实时业务需求。
3. 多层次安全保障
华为云在数据传输过程中提供端到端的安全保障,包括数据加密、访问控制、身份认证等。通过与Java应用的安全框架(如Spring Security)集成,华为云能够确保队列传输中的数据不被篡改或泄露,满足企业级安全合规要求。
华为云Java队列传输的典型应用场景
1. 异步任务处理
在电商、金融等行业中,高并发场景下的异步任务处理是常见需求。通过华为云的消息队列服务,Java开发者可以将耗时任务(如订单处理、支付通知)放入队列,由后台服务异步消费,避免阻塞主业务逻辑。
2. 微服务间通信
在微服务架构中,服务之间的解耦是关键。华为云的消息队列可以作为服务间的通信桥梁,Java应用通过生产-消费模式实现松耦合,提升系统的可扩展性和可维护性。
3. 大数据流处理
对于需要实时处理海量数据的场景(如日志分析、用户行为追踪),华为云的消息队列能够高效收集和分发数据流,Java应用可以结合流处理框架(如Flink或Kafka Streams)实现实时计算与分析。
如何通过华为云代理商部署Java队列传输
1. 环境准备与资源申请
通过华为云代理商,企业可以快速申请消息队列服务实例,并获取相应的访问密钥和SDK支持。代理商还提供专业技术支持,帮助开发者快速搭建Java开发环境。
2. 代码集成与配置
华为云提供完善的Java SDK和API文档,开发者可以通过Maven或Gradle轻松引入依赖。代理商还能提供代码示例和最佳实践,帮助开发者快速实现队列的生产与消费逻辑。
3. 监控与运维支持
华为云的监控服务(如Cloud Eye)可以实时追踪队列的健康状态和性能指标。代理商还能提供运维支持,确保Java应用的队列传输长期稳定运行。
总结
本文详细介绍了华为云在Java队列传输中的核心优势,包括高可靠性、高性能和安全性,并列举了典型应用场景。通过华为云代理商的支持,企业可以更加便捷地部署和管理Java队列传输服务,提升业务系统的整体效率。华为云凭借其强大的技术能力和完善的生态体系,为Java开发者提供了值得信赖的云服务解决方案。
发布者:luotuoemo,转转请注明出处:https://www.jintuiyun.com/394345.html